While most customers had to-go orders, we ate at the café. The coffee and tea were delicious. Authentic NY bagels loaded with cream cheese. The bacon-egg-cheese sandwich was bursting with flavor. There is a gift shop and ice cream parlor connected to the café. Definitely a place to check out.

Finally! A decent breakfast/bagel spot within easy biking/walking distance from the neighborhood! No more needing to rely on ho-hum national chain Funkin' Donuts for your BEC fix!

Very friendly staff will hook you up. They also have a few fun hot sauces around to spice up your sammich - after trying them all, can confirm the Hawaiian hot sauce is easily the best.

The coffee is also surprisingly good! Both hot and iced, tho the iced with 1 pump of vanilla + oat milk was our crowd favorite.

I think they do have pastries but they were always sold out by the time i was there in the mid-morning (9-10am) - i think they do a very big early morning business (they open at 630!)

Note there is no bathroom here. There is also no easy bike parking/docks, probably the only tip I would offer to improve!

I ordered the fried chicken on an everything bagel. disappointing. The "fried chicken" breast was just a processed patty. Like you get in the frozen section of your grocery store. I paid an additional 3 dollars for bacon. The bacon WAS NOT worth it. This bacon was pathetic. Undercooked and underwhelming. The entire 🥪 was just OK.
